In the coagulation cascade, chemicals called clotting factors (or coagulation factors) prompt reactions that activate still more coagulation factors. The process is complex, but is initiated along two basic pathways: The extrinsic pathway, which normally is triggered by trauma. Alternatively, coagulation may be initiated through the “intrinsic pathway” when factor XII is activated on a charged surface by a process called contact activation.

The coagulation pathway is a cascade of events that leads to hemostasis. The intricate pathway allows for rapid healing and prevention of spontaneous bleeding. Two paths, intrinsic and extrinsic, originate separately but converge at a specific point, leading to fibrin activation.

When assembled on an activation surface, the contact system (FXII, PK and HK) becomes activated and stimulates the intrinsic pathway of coagulation by activating FXI. The coagulation cascade is a traditional representation of these processes that is useful in understanding and interpreting the coagulation profile. The extrinsic pathway is activated by tissue factor, produced within subendothelial tissue and exposed to the circulation in the setting of endothelial damage.
